Multimodal transportation network with cargo containerization technology: Advantages and challenges

Xuehao Feng et al.

Summary: This study investigates a bulk cargo distribution problem in a multimodal transportation network considering both the transportation modes of inland waterways and containerization technology. A mixed-integer linear programming model is developed to optimize transportation mode selection, vehicle routing, depot selection, and cargo quantity for containerization. Numerical experiments based on the Yangtze River network show that containerization transportation can decrease total transportation costs. The study provides insight into the decision making of logistics companies and government policymaking.

Study of the Multimodal Freight Transport Sector in Romania: Analysis of the External and Internal Environment

Desdemona Isabela Scarisoreanu et al.

Summary: This paper examines the current situation of the multimodal freight transport sector in Romania by analyzing its external and internal environment. The goal is to identify the strengths and weaknesses of this sector and determine the strategies needed to achieve the targets set by the European Green Deal. The EU emphasizes the importance of multimodal transport, particularly rail transport, in reducing pollution. Despite challenges such as the aging workforce in the railway sector and a labor shortage in road transport, the multimodal freight transport market in Romania remains attractive. To ensure a competitive advantage, a strategy focusing on stimulating rail freight transport and reducing pollution needs to be implemented.

Deep physical neural networks trained with backpropagation

Logan G. Wright et al.

Summary: The study introduced a hybrid in situ-in silico algorithm called physics-aware training, which applies backpropagation to train controllable physical systems for deep physical neural networks. By demonstrating the training of diverse physical neural networks in areas like optics, mechanics, and electronics to perform audio and image classification tasks, the research showcased the universality and effectiveness of the approach.
